摘要:本文首先推导证明当参考模型和实际系统不相吻合时,根据参考模型建立的Kalman滤波器所产生的估计残差将与模型的偏离程度成正比,据此给出故障检测方法;其次推导出状态偏差形式的系统方程;最后将B·Friedland提出的分离估计法推广到状态偏差估计中,并进一步提出状态偏差估计的二级分解算法。
In this paper,it is shown that the residual process produced by kalman's filter which is based on the reference system is directly proportional to the mismatch degree of model, and a method of fault detectoon is presented. In addition, system equation in state error form is given. For simplifying estimation, the two-decomposition algorithm for state error estimation is also proposed. By various simulations, it is shown that us-ing this mathod we not only can judge whether there are fault but also can effectively estimate the process state, state error, and fault variables in system.
